Snickerdoodles Recipe

Ingredients:

1 1/2 C.sugar
1/2 C. butter,softened
1/2 C. shortening
2 eggs
2 3/4 C. flour
2 tsp cream of tartar
1 tsp baking soda
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 C. sugar
2 tsp cinnamon

Directions:

Preheat oven 400ºF. Mix 1 1/2c. sugar, butter, shortening and eggs. Stir in flour, cream of tartar, baking soda and salt. Shape into 1 1/4 inch balls.
Mix 1/4 C. sugar and cinnamon. Roll balls in mixture. Place 2 inches apart on ungreased cookie sheet. Bake 8-10 minutes. Remove to cooling rack immediately from oven.
Makes 3 Dozen
